Starting with Lattermill SDK v3, every plugin must forward the `x-lm-trace` header on all outbound calls between microservices. If your plugin spawns background work, copy the trace context into the job payload before enqueueing, or downstream spans will be orphaned. Verify propagation by running the bundled `tracecheck` tool against your staging deployment and confirming a single unbroken trace tree. Trace spans are persisted to the shared trace store; configure your plugin to write there using the connection string below.

database URL for tajog-bajeg: mysql://soreth_svc:OzsCjhu@db-6997.nelvrostack.internal:5432/kelax

## Tallygrid — Environments

The inventory reconciliation job runs in three environments: dev, staging, prod. Dev uses a synthetic warehouse feed and resets nightly. Staging mirrors prod data with a one-day lag; safe for replay testing. Prod runs at 02:30 and pages on-call if the diff phase exceeds the variance threshold. Never point staging at prod write endpoints. Deploys promote dev → staging → prod, no skips. Each environment is driven by the configuration below.

service settings:
PRAIX_LOG_LEVEL=error
PRAIX_METRICS_HOST=metrics.praix.qorvelcorp.corp
PRAIX_POOL_SIZE=16

### Account Recovery — Chattervane Log Sampling

Quick context for review: Chattervane spams about 40k log lines a minute, so the account-recovery flow now samples at 1:50 for INFO and keeps 100% of WARN and above. Recovery attempts are tagged `acct-rec` and always exempt from sampling — please verify that exemption in the diff, it's bitten us before. If sampling config changes lock the recovery console (it happens), re-authenticate with the admin fallback and enter the passphrase below.

vault phrase of kafog-kahif = holdor-rusir-praox